Zelboraf Approved for Late-Stage Melanoma

WebMD Health  Wed, 08/17/2011 - 16:38

Sunburned woman

The FDA today approved Zelboraf (vemurafenib) for the treatment of advanced or metastatic melanoma.

The drug extends survival for the 50% of melanoma patients whose tumors carry the BRAF mutation.
